Operational Description

FCC ID: T8860001 Technical Description : The brief circuit description is listed as follows : - Q2, Q3 and associated circuit act as RF Amplifier and Modulator. - X1, Q1 and associated circuit act as 27.145 MHz Oscillator. - U1 EM78P153S acts as Encoder. - SW2 acts as Channel Switch. - F, B, L and R act as Control Keys. - D1 and associated circuit act as Voltage Regulator. Antenna Used : An integral antenna (non-extendable) has been used.
